A young man from Mount Vernon, New York, who found his first stage in a church basement. This documentary traces the path of Denzel Washington from a hesitant actor to a cultural icon, exploring the discipline, faith, and quiet integrity that forged a two-time Oscar winner. The 2022 film is less a chronicle of fame and more a portrait of an American archetype, examining how his choices on and off screen have resonated for decades. A compelling documentary about legacy, craft, and what it means to lead by example.

The documentary adopts a straightforward chronological approach, tracing Washington's journey with a respectful but somewhat conventional reverence. The atmosphere feels more like an authorized biography than a critical exploration.
Fans of Washington's work will appreciate the career-spanning footage and insights into his process, though those seeking deeper analysis may find it surface-level. You'll come away with admiration for the man's discipline and consistency. — MovieFinder Editorial
